How much does a Health Informatics Specialist I make in Alaska? The average Health Informatics Specialist I salary in Alaska is $86,590 as of April 24, 2024, but the range typically falls between $75,990 and $97,690.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.

Job Description

The Health Informatics Specialist I implements electronic health record (EHR) systems, bed management systems, computerized physician order entry systems, or any other relevant health information systems. Designs, implements, maintains, and analyzes data from clinical informatics systems. Being a Health Informatics Specialist I evaluates and recommends improvements to systems. Analyzes data produced by these systems to identify trends and areas for improvement and to ensure systems are functioning properly. In addition, Health Informatics Specialist I may provide staff training on new or updated systems. Typically requires a bachelor's degree in informatics and/or nursing. Typically reports to a manager. Being a Health Informatics Specialist I work is closely managed.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. Working as a Health Informatics Specialist I typ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
